Output 03a1396d8a9c93119f32e333f7a04e14c2890cbc96e89c78d75c33cd64da8197:3

value
25695
script pubkey
OP_0 OP_PUSHBYTES_20 d2bce39c323f405057a3985b8bb1199f62bb3d6e
address
bc1q627w88pj8aq9q4arnpdchvgena3tk0tw83uet5
transaction
03a1396d8a9c93119f32e333f7a04e14c2890cbc96e89c78d75c33cd64da8197
spent
true